What does Revelation 15:8 mean?
Revelation 15:8 is a verse in the book of Revelation, in the New Testament. In the original Greek, key words include καί (kai), ναός (naos), γεμίζω (gemizo). It connects to 18 cross-referenced passages elsewhere in Scripture.
